The DOFF Brick Cleaning System in Broadland Row
The DOFF brick Cleaning System is frequently used in Broadland Row for stone cleaning, but it's flexibility also extends to cleaning brickwork, and there are a number of advantages that set it apart from other brick cleaning methods:
Gentle Cleaning Action:
The DOFF system utilizes a combination of high-temperature steam and low-pressure water, offering a gentle cleaning action that is particularly appropriate for fragile brickwork. This guarantees that the surface is thoroughly cleaned without causing damage or erosion to the bricks.
Efficient Removal of Biological Growth:
Biological growth on brick surfaces, such as algae and moss, can be successfully removed by the DOFF system. The high-temperature steam not only cleans the visible growth but also removes spores, preventing regrowth. This efficiency surpasses traditional techniques that might not deal with the source of biological invasions.
Preservation of Historic Features:
When dealing with historic or listed buildings, maintaining the credibility of the brickwork is critical. The DOFF system's gentle yet powerful cleaning process guarantees that historic functions, such as original brick texture and colour, are maintained, maintaining the integrity and authenticity of the structure.
Environmentally Friendly Approach:
The DOFF system uses high-temperature steam without the need for extreme chemicals. This environmentally friendly approach aligns with modern sustainability practices, making it a preferred choice over approaches that may involve the use of chemical cleaners harmful to both the environment and the brickwork.
Prevention of Damage to Mortar Joints:
Traditional high-pressure cleaning methods can unintentionally cause damage to mortar joints, resulting in prospective structural problems. The DOFF system's low-pressure water and steam combination minimise the danger of mortar joint damage, making sure that the cleaning procedure works without compromising the stability of the brickwork.
Precision and Control:
The DOFF system offers accurate control over both temperature and pressure. This level of control enables a customized method to different types of brickwork and conditions. Such precision makes sure that the cleaning process is optimised for the specific needs of each task, surpassing approaches that may lack this degree of flexibility.
Reduced Downtime and Disruption:
The effectiveness of the DOFF system indicates that cleaning projects can be completed more quickly than with some traditional methods. Lowered downtime is particularly useful for services or property owners who want minimal disruption to their everyday activities or operations throughout the cleaning procedure.
In summary, the DOFF brick wall Cleaning System provides a series of benefits that make it a exceptional choice for cleaning brickwork compared to other techniques. Its mild yet efficient cleaning action, efficient removal of biological growth, preservation of historic features, environmentally friendly technique, prevention of damage to mortar joints, precision and control, and reduced downtime, collectively position the DOFF system as a top-tier option for maintaining and restoring the beauty of brick surface areas.
